Slightly tweak USB command names.
This commit is contained in:
@@ -8,5 +8,5 @@ setInterval(() => {
|
|||||||
areLedsEnabled = !areLedsEnabled;
|
areLedsEnabled = !areLedsEnabled;
|
||||||
const brightnessPercent = areLedsEnabled ? 100 : 0;
|
const brightnessPercent = areLedsEnabled ? 100 : 0;
|
||||||
|
|
||||||
device.write(uhk.getTransferData(new Buffer([uhk.usbCommands.setLedPwm, brightnessPercent])));
|
device.write(uhk.getTransferData(new Buffer([uhk.usbCommands.setLedPwmBrightness, brightnessPercent])));
|
||||||
}, 500);
|
}, 500);
|
||||||
|
|||||||
@@ -3,14 +3,14 @@ const uhk = require('./uhk');
|
|||||||
|
|
||||||
const device = uhk.getUhkDevice();
|
const device = uhk.getUhkDevice();
|
||||||
|
|
||||||
function readAdc() {
|
function getAdcValue() {
|
||||||
const data = uhk.getTransferData(new Buffer([uhk.usbCommands.readAdc]));
|
const data = uhk.getTransferData(new Buffer([uhk.usbCommands.getAdcValue]));
|
||||||
console.log('Sending ', data);
|
console.log('Sending ', data);
|
||||||
device.write(data);
|
device.write(data);
|
||||||
const receivedBuffer = Buffer.from(device.readSync());
|
const receivedBuffer = Buffer.from(device.readSync());
|
||||||
console.log('Received', uhk.bufferToString(receivedBuffer), (receivedBuffer[2]*255 + receivedBuffer[1])/4096*5.5*1.045);
|
console.log('Received', uhk.bufferToString(receivedBuffer), (receivedBuffer[2]*255 + receivedBuffer[1])/4096*5.5*1.045);
|
||||||
|
|
||||||
setTimeout(readAdc, 500)
|
setTimeout(getAdcValue, 500)
|
||||||
}
|
}
|
||||||
|
|
||||||
readAdc();
|
getAdcValue();
|
||||||
|
|||||||
@@ -2,13 +2,13 @@
|
|||||||
const uhk = require('./uhk');
|
const uhk = require('./uhk');
|
||||||
const device = uhk.getUhkDevice();
|
const device = uhk.getUhkDevice();
|
||||||
|
|
||||||
function readDebugInfo() {
|
function getDebugInfo() {
|
||||||
const payload = new Buffer([uhk.usbCommands.readDebugInfo]);
|
const payload = new Buffer([uhk.usbCommands.readDebugInfo]);
|
||||||
console.log('Sending ', uhk.bufferToString(payload));
|
console.log('Sending ', uhk.bufferToString(payload));
|
||||||
device.write(uhk.getTransferData(payload));
|
device.write(uhk.getTransferData(payload));
|
||||||
const receivedBuffer = Buffer.from(device.readSync());
|
const receivedBuffer = Buffer.from(device.readSync());
|
||||||
console.log('Received', uhk.bufferToString(receivedBuffer));
|
console.log('Received', uhk.bufferToString(receivedBuffer));
|
||||||
setTimeout(readDebugInfo, 500);
|
setTimeout(getDebugInfo, 500);
|
||||||
}
|
}
|
||||||
|
|
||||||
readDebugInfo();
|
getDebugInfo();
|
||||||
|
|||||||
@@ -33,6 +33,6 @@ if (kbootCommand !== 'idle') {
|
|||||||
}
|
}
|
||||||
|
|
||||||
const device = uhk.getUhkDevice();
|
const device = uhk.getUhkDevice();
|
||||||
let transfer = new Buffer([uhk.usbCommands.sendKbootCommand, kbootCommandId, parseInt(i2cAddress)]);
|
let transfer = new Buffer([uhk.usbCommands.sendKbootCommandToModule, kbootCommandId, parseInt(i2cAddress)]);
|
||||||
device.write(uhk.getTransferData(transfer));
|
device.write(uhk.getTransferData(transfer));
|
||||||
const response = Buffer.from(device.readSync());
|
const response = Buffer.from(device.readSync());
|
||||||
|
|||||||
@@ -10,4 +10,4 @@ if (process.argv.length !== 3) {
|
|||||||
}
|
}
|
||||||
|
|
||||||
let leftBrightnessPercent = process.argv[2] || '';
|
let leftBrightnessPercent = process.argv[2] || '';
|
||||||
device.write(uhk.getTransferData(new Buffer([uhk.usbCommands.setLedPwm, +leftBrightnessPercent])));
|
device.write(uhk.getTransferData(new Buffer([uhk.usbCommands.setLedPwmBrightness, +leftBrightnessPercent])));
|
||||||
|
|||||||
@@ -56,16 +56,16 @@ exports = module.exports = moduleExports = {
|
|||||||
setTestLed: 2,
|
setTestLed: 2,
|
||||||
writeUserConfig: 8,
|
writeUserConfig: 8,
|
||||||
applyConfig: 9,
|
applyConfig: 9,
|
||||||
setLedPwm: 10,
|
setLedPwmBrightness: 10,
|
||||||
readAdc: 11,
|
getAdcValue: 11,
|
||||||
launchEepromTransfer: 12,
|
launchEepromTransfer: 12,
|
||||||
readHardwareConfig: 13,
|
readHardwareConfig: 13,
|
||||||
writeHardwareConfig: 14,
|
writeHardwareConfig: 14,
|
||||||
readUserConfig: 15,
|
readUserConfig: 15,
|
||||||
getKeyboardState: 16,
|
getKeyboardState: 16,
|
||||||
readDebugInfo: 17,
|
getDebugInfo: 17,
|
||||||
jumpToModuleBootloader: 18,
|
jumpToModuleBootloader: 18,
|
||||||
sendKbootCommand: 19,
|
sendKbootCommandToModule: 19,
|
||||||
},
|
},
|
||||||
enumerationModes: {
|
enumerationModes: {
|
||||||
bootloader: 0,
|
bootloader: 0,
|
||||||
|
|||||||
Reference in New Issue
Block a user